Kompetensi Inti
3.11 Menerapkan prosedur instalasi Server Softswitch berbasis
session initial protocol (SIP).
4.11 Menginstalasi Server softswitch berbasis
session initial protocol (SIP).
Pengertian Softswitch
Softswitch
adalah suatu alat yang mampu menghubungkan antara jaringan sirkuit dengan
jaringan paket, termasuk di dalamnya adalah jaringan telpon tetap (PSTN),
internet yang berbasis IP, kabel TV dan juga jaringan seluler yang telah ada
selama ini.
Softswitch
merupakan kumpulan dari beberapa perangkat protokol dan aplikasi yang
memungkinkan perangkat-perangkat lain dapat mengakses layanan telekomunikasi
atau internet berbasis jaringan IO, dimana seluruh prosesnya dilakukan dengan
menjalankan software pada suatu sitem komputer.
Konsep Kerja
Server Softswitch
Ketika
pelanggan gateway dan telepon Ip mengirimkan sinyal satu sama lain dalam
jaringan paket dengan menggunakan protokol Ip teleponi seperti H.323 atau SIP.
Setelah sinyal diterima softswitch akan mengidentifikasikan panggilan yang
masuk apakah berasl dari jaringan PSTN atau Jaringan IP . Jika dipanggil menggunakan
jaringan IP, softswitch akan menginstrusikan originating customer gateway dan
terminating customer gateway untuk merutekan packetized voice stream secara
langsung. Softswitch mengontrol pembentukan (setup) dan pemutusan (release)
Pengertian PBX
PBX
(Private Branch Exchange) yaitu penyedia layanan telepon yang melayani
pertukaran telepon dengan pusat di dalam suatu perusahaan, dan menjadi
penghubung antara telepon dari publik ke telepon perusahaan atau jaringan
telepon dari perusahaan ke jaringan perusahaan lainnya di area yang lebih luas
sehingga dapat tercakup oleh publik. PBX menghubungkan jaringan telepon dengan
jaringan lokal dengan Trunk. Trunk adalah penghubung jalur komunikasi antara pengirim
dengan penerima melalui central office.
Fungsi
PBX
1.Membuat
koneksi (sirkuit) atau menghubungkan antara telepon pengguna dengan telepon
yang dituju
2.Menjaga koneksi
atau sambungan selama menggunakan telepon
3.Mematikan
koneksi sesuai dengan perintah pengguna telepon
4.Menyediakan
informasi untuk kepentingan akuntansi
5.Layanan
otomatis panggilan.
Cara
Kerja PBX dalam Server Softswitch
Sebuah
sistem IP PBX terdiri dari satu atau lebih telepon SIP dan secara opsional VOIP
gateway untuk terhubung ke jalur server, klien SIP, baik berupa software.
IP
PBX server adalah sebuah sistim yang mempunyai fungsi utama menyediakan layanan
VoIP (Voice Over IP) mulai dari
registrasi user, call routing, call conference, interactive voice
response, call forwarding, caller id, voice mail dan sebagainya. Dalam sebuah
jaringan VoIP, selain terdapat IP PBX server, juga terdapat beberapa client
yang dapat saling berkomunikasi dengan baik dengan perantaraan IP PBX ini. Prinsip kerja dari sistim layanan VoIP adalah sebagai berikut : Client-client yang
terhubung dalam sistim tersebut mempunyai nomor IP Address sendiri. Untuk bisa
berkomunikasi antar client, maka masing-masing client harus ter-register di IP
PBX Server. Setelah diregistrasi, setiap
client akan mendapat nomor user (user account). Sebuah client, jika ingin
berkomunikasi dengan client lain harus
men-dial nomor user dari client tujuan sesuai
dengan nomor registrasi yang diberikan oleh IP PBX server. Komunikasi
antar client ini selalu dimonitor oleh server.
Asterisk
Asterisk adalah salah satu software Server VoIP yang didistribusikan melalui GPL (GNU General Public License) dimana seperti software open source lainnya, dapat didownload gratis dari internet. Asterisk disebut sebagai IP PBX, karena memiliki fungsi dan kemampuan layaknya PBX namun berbasis IP. Seperti dijelaskan sebelumnya, di dalam jaringan VoIP selain terdapat IP PBX Server juga terdapat beberapa client. Ada dua jenis client yang dapat dihubungkan dengan IP PBX server (selain client pesawat telepon analog), yaitu Client IP Phone dan Softphone. IP Phone berbentuk pesawat telepon yang koneksinya berbasis IP. Karena berbasis IP, IP Phone mempunyai konektor jaringan seperti RJ45, wireless LAN USB, serta mempunyai konfigurasi IP seperti perangkat jaringan yang lain. Umumnya IP Phone dilengkapi dengan display untuk konfigurasi jaringan dan koneksi atau registrasi ke server VoIP. Softphone merupakan aplikasi VoIP client yang dapat di install di PC (baik desktop maupun laptop). Konfigurasi yang dilakukan di Softphone kurang lebih sama dengan IP Phone terutama untuk registrasi ke server VoIP, hanya saja softphone lebih fleksibel dalam memilih codec yang akan digunakan,
Gambar 1 menunjukkan IP Phone dan Softphone X-lite.
Konfigurasi
Jaringan
Konfigurasi
jaringan yang akan dibuat dalam praktikum ditunjukkan pada gambar2. Peralatan
yang diperlukan untuk membuat jaringan tersebut adalah sebagai berikut :
masing-masing grup dilayani oleh IP-PBX.
IP-PBX melayani segment yang meliputi softphone dilengkapi dengan headset, IP
Phone
Gambar konfigurasi jaringan voip IPPBX
Konfigurasi
IP-PBX
Perintah-perintah
konfigurasi di bawah ini berlaku hanya untuk grup1, untuk grup-grup yang lain
hanya tinggal mengubah nomor member Konfigurasi untuk registrasi user lokal dan
hubungan antar IP-PBX Bagian ini berisi konfigurasi file sip.conf dimana user VoIP ter-register. Untuk melakukan registrasi, edit file sip.conf dengan mengetik nano /etc/asterisk/sip.conf.
pada saat masuk ke file sip.conf, ketik perintah di bawah ini pada bagian
paling akhir dari isi file sip.conf.
Dial
Plan.
Dial
Plan berfungsi sebagai routing panggilan antar extension baik yang berada dalam
satu IP-PBX (lokal) maupun antar IP-PBX, atau biasa disebut dial trunk. Dalam
Asterisk, Dial Plan diprogram dalam satu file yang bernama extensions.conf.
Secara umum, setiap extension dalam Asterisk merujuk pada user tertentu yang
ter-register ke Asterisk tersebut sehingga biasanya nomor extension sama dengan
id user. Dial Plan yang dibuat meliputi :
a. Dial antar extension dalam satu IP-PBX
b. Dial antar extension antar IP-PBX
Untuk
mengkonfigurasi dial plan, edit file
extensions.conf dengan mengetik
vi /etc/asterisk/extensions.conf.. Ketik
perintah di bawah ini pada bagian paling akhir dari isi file extensions.conf.
A.
Alat dan Bahan
Peralatan :
PC
dengan OS Linux Debian
PC
dengan software X-Lite(sebagai client)
WAP
TPLink 800
B.
Langkah
kerja
1. Konfigurasi
ekstensi dan dial plan
[general]
context=default
port=5060
bindaddr=0.0.0.0
srvlookup=yes
tos=0x18
videosupport=yes
;register
ke asterisk IP-PBX
register
=> 100:100@No.IP IP PBX
;softphone
[101]
type=friend
username=101
secret=101
host=dynamic
nat=no
dtmfmode=rfc2833
allow=all
callerid="sip00"
context=kelas
canreinvite=no
mailbox=101@kelas
;ip-phone
[102]
type=friend
username=102
secret=102
host=dynamic
nat=no
dtmfmode=rfc2833
allow=all
callerid="sip01"
context=kelas
canreinvite=no
mailbox=102@kelas
;dial
antar ekstension pada IP-PBX1
[kelas]
exten
=> 101,1,Dial(SIP/101,20)
exten
=> 101,2,Hangup
exten
=> 102,1,Dial(SIP/102,20)
exten
=> 102,2,Hangup
0 Response to "KOMUNIKASI VOIP"
Post a Comment